Isaac Gym 4预览包压缩文件解析
需积分: 0 116 浏览量
更新于2024-10-01
收藏 191.82MB GZ 举报
资源摘要信息: "IsaacGym_Preview_4_Package.tar.gz"
IsaacGym是由NVIDIA开发的一款高性能仿真平台,它是基于他们自家的物理引擎PhysX进行开发,专注于为机器人学习领域提供强大的仿真支持。从标题来看,此文件名为 "IsaacGym_Preview_4_Package.tar.gz",这暗示了它可能是一个预览版软件包。文件名中的“4”可能表示是第四版的预览包,而“.tar.gz”是常见的压缩文件格式,表明此文件为一个归档包,需要使用相应的解压缩工具打开。
IsaacGym的核心特点是能够模拟复杂和多样化的3D环境,并能进行并行计算。并行计算是通过利用GPU的强大计算能力来实现的,这允许在训练机器学习模型时同时进行大量的仿真计算。这一点对于需要处理大量数据和复杂交互的机器人学习任务来说,是非常有价值的。在机器学习尤其是强化学习领域中,这种能力可以显著提高学习效率和模型的训练速度。
从描述上来看,我们无法获得更多的信息,因为它仅仅重复了文件名。然而,我们可以推断,该文件可能是IsaacGym的开发者社区所共享的一个更新的预览版,预览版通常用于在正式版发布之前收集用户的反馈和测试软件的稳定性和性能。
对于文件名称列表中的“isaacgym”,我们可以假设该压缩包内可能包含了与IsaacGym相关的各种文件,如执行文件、源代码、库文件、配置文件、文档以及可能的API接口说明等。这些文件对于开发者来说是了解和利用IsaacGym平台进行机器人模拟和学习训练的关键资源。
对于想要深入了解IsaacGym的IT专业人员来说,以下是一些相关的知识点:
1. PhysX:PhysX是NVIDIA开发的一款先进的物理引擎,它支持实时物理模拟计算,比如碰撞检测、粒子系统、布料仿真等。IsaacGym利用PhysX来模拟真实的物理环境,为机器人学习提供高度真实的训练场景。
2. 机器人学习(Robot Learning):机器人学习是AI领域的一个分支,它涉及到使用机器学习技术让机器人通过与环境的交互来学习任务。IsaacGym提供了适合训练各种机器人行为的环境。
3. 并行计算与GPU:并行计算是指同时使用多个计算资源解决计算问题的过程。GPU(图形处理单元)由于其高度并行的架构非常适合处理并行计算任务,特别是在机器学习领域。IsaacGym使用GPU来进行大规模并行仿真计算。
4. 强化学习(Reinforcement Learning, RL):强化学习是一种学习范式,其中一个智能体(agent)通过与环境的交互来学习策略,以便最大化某种累积奖励。IsaacGym环境可以用于开发和测试强化学习算法。
5. 深度学习(Deep Learning):深度学习是机器学习的一个子领域,它使用深度神经网络进行各种任务。在IsaacGym中,深度学习经常用于提高智能体的行为决策能力。
6. 开源软件(Open Source Software):尽管文件名没有明确表示IsaacGym是否开源,但很多高级仿真工具和平台都是开源的,以促进社区合作和快速迭代。IsaacGym是否开源可以成为开发者关注的一个点。
7. 仿真软件(Simulation Software):仿真软件通常用于创建一个虚拟环境来模拟真实世界的各种情况,这在机器人开发和AI研究中非常重要。IsaacGym就是这类软件的一个实例。
综上所述,IsaacGym是一个高度专业化的工具,它能为研究人员和开发者提供强大的仿真环境,用于推进机器人学习和人工智能领域的研究。了解和掌握IsaacGym,需要对上述相关知识领域有较深入的理解。
2022-01-14 上传
2022-01-13 上传
2022-02-11 上传
2022-01-28 上传
2022-01-13 上传
2022-02-01 上传
2022-02-10 上传
2022-01-28 上传
2022-01-13 上传
LinZhou1024
- 粉丝: 0
- 资源: 1
最新资源
- 探索数据转换实验平台在设备装置中的应用
- 使用git-log-to-tikz.py将Git日志转换为TIKZ图形
- 小栗子源码2.9.3版本发布
- 使用Tinder-Hack-Client实现Tinder API交互
- Android Studio新模板:个性化Material Design导航抽屉
- React API分页模块:数据获取与页面管理
- C语言实现顺序表的动态分配方法
- 光催化分解水产氢固溶体催化剂制备技术揭秘
- VS2013环境下tinyxml库的32位与64位编译指南
- 网易云歌词情感分析系统实现与架构
- React应用展示GitHub用户详细信息及项目分析
- LayUI2.1.6帮助文档API功能详解
- 全栈开发实现的chatgpt应用可打包小程序/H5/App
- C++实现顺序表的动态内存分配技术
- Java制作水果格斗游戏:策略与随机性的结合
- 基于若依框架的后台管理系统开发实例解析